Product Description

Bosch Rexroth is the manufacturer of the motors in the MSK motor series, which are used for different applications. The motors in this series are characterized by high dynamics and improved precision due to their enhanced encoder systems. They also have a compact construction and high torque density and are designed to be rotary main and servo drive motors. Some of their applications include machine tools, printing and paper processing machines, food processing and packaging machines, metal forming machines, and robotics.

The MSK100B-0200-NN-M1-AP1-NNNN is an MSK motor model fitted with a shaft with a keyway and radial shaft sealing ring that prevents fluid from entering the shaft. Its radial shaft sealing is designed according to the requirements of DIN 3760 - Design A. This MDD model has a holding brake that holds the axle when the motor is disconnected from power. The holding brake operates with the principle of electrical release and has a holding torque of 32 Nm. Additionally, the motor is equipped with a multiturn encoder with the Hiperface interface. This encoder uses optical measurement and has a system accuracy of ±80 angular seconds. It allows the absolute, indirect evaluation of the motor’s position within 4,096 mechanical rotations.

Natural convection is the suitable cooling method for the MSK100B-0200-NN-M1-AP1-NNNN based on its housing design. In this cooling method, heat is dissipated to the ambient air and by conduction to the machine construction. The housing varnish consists of a black (RAL9005) 2K epoxy resin coating based on epoxy polyamide resin in water. This coat displays high chemical resistance against diluted acids/alkaline solutions, water, seawater, sewage, and current mineral oils and limited resistance against organic solvents and hydraulic oil.

MSK100B-0200-NN-M1-AP1-NNNN Technical Specifications

Continuous Current at Standstill 100 K: 17.3 A
Continuous Torque at Standstill 100 K: 33.0 Nm
Maximum Current: 66.2 A
Maximum Torque: 102.0 Nm
Winding Inductivity: 7,600 mH
